img.alignright{float:right}.inner_banner{min-height:100vh;background:linear-gradient(-90deg,#ffffff00,#00000033),url(//www.intensiv-filter-himenviro.com/wp-content/themes/himenviro/assets/css/../img/inner.jpg);display:inline-flex;width:100%;align-items:end;color:#fff;background-size:cover;background-position:0 100%;background-attachment:fixed}.inner_banner.centerr{align-items:center}.inner_banner h3{color:#0e0f3b;background:#fff;padding:30px 15px;display:inline-flex;justify-content:center;align-items:center;font-weight:700;text-transform:uppercase;width:300px;height:300px}.inner_banner .title p{color:#fff;font-size:16px}.inner_banner .title span{font-size:18px;margin-bottom:5px;display:inline-block;font-weight:600;border-bottom:2px solid #41bec2;transform:translateX(-150%);transition:.8s}.inner_banner .industry_page.animation_tag.title{margin-top:35%}.inner_banner .title.animate span{transform:translateX(0%);transition-delay:1.5s}.about_us.inner ul li{background:#f9f9f9}.about_us.inner{color:#272727;padding:60px 0;background:#fff}.about_us.inner ul li h5{font-size:22px;margin-bottom:5px}.global_inner{background:#fff;padding:60px 0}.industry .owl-nav{text-align:center;opacity:0;display:none}.industry.inner{padding:60px 0}.products .product_box:hover h2:before{width:100%}.products .product_box:hover h2{color:#fff!important}.products .product_box h2:before{position:absolute;top:0;left:0;display:block;width:0;height:100%;content:'';-webkit-transition:width .3s ease;-o-transition:width .3s ease;transition:width .3s ease;background:#009de0;z-index:-1}.products{background:#e2ebf2}.products ul{display:inline-flex;width:100%;list-style:none;flex-wrap:wrap;align-items:center}.products ul li{width:16.6%}.products.inner{padding:30px 0}.products .product_box h2{font-size:16px;color:#009de0;background:#fff;margin-right:8px;padding:10px 0;font-weight:700;text-align:center;text-transform:uppercase;margin-bottom:8px;position:relative;z-index:2;height:50px;display:flex;flex-wrap:wrap;align-items:center;justify-content:center}.product_list .product_box:after{background:#e8f0ff}.products.inner .product_box{position:relative}.products.inner .breadcrumb{background:0 0;font-size:14px;font-weight:900;padding:0 0 30px;margin:0}.products.inner .breadcrumb a{color:#868686;margin:0 8px;font-weight:600}.indu_content{background:#fff;padding:30px}.products.induinner{background:0 0;padding:60px 15px}.products .indu_content li{width:25%}.sub_content .indu_content{padding:0}.sub_content .indu_content li a{text-align:center;font-weight:900;padding:2px;color:#000;text-transform:uppercase}.sub_content .indu_content .tab-content{padding:30px}.sub_content .indu_content .nav-tabs{border-bottom:2px solid #009de0}.sub_content .indu_content .nav-tabs .nav-link.active{background:#009de0;color:#fff;border:none;border-radius:0}.sub_content .indu_content .nav-tabs .nav-link.active:hover{color:#fff}.sub_content .indu_content .nav-tabs .nav-link:hover{border-bottom:1px solid;color:#009de0}.client_list{margin:40px 0}.products .client_list ul li{text-align:center;padding:20px 5px}.products .client_list ul li img{height:150px;object-fit:contain;width:100%;transition:.5s}.products .client_list ul li:hover img{transform:translateY(-15px)}.solutions .products ul{justify-content:space-between}.solutions.inner_banner h3{width:100%;color:#fff;background:0 0;height:auto}.solutions.inner_banner .products.inner{padding:0 0 30px;background:0 0}.solutions.inner_banner .products.inner .breadcrumb a{color:#fff}.solutions.inner_banner .products ul li:nth-child(1){width:25%}.solutions.inner_banner .products ul li:nth-child(2){width:25%}.solutions.inner_banner .products ul li:nth-child(3){width:25%}.solutions.inner_banner .products ul li:nth-child(4){width:25%}.solutions.inner_banner .products .product_box h2{font-size:16px;color:#009de0;background:#fff;margin-right:8px;padding:10px 0;font-weight:700;text-align:center;text-transform:uppercase;margin-bottom:8px;position:relative;z-index:2;height:50px;display:flex;flex-wrap:wrap;align-items:center;justify-content:center}.solutions.inner_banner .products.induinner{background:0 0;transform:translateY(22%);margin-bottom:2%;padding:75px 15px}.solutions_main2 .product_list ul li:nth-child(1){width:25%}.solutions_main2 .product_list ul li:nth-child(2){width:25%}.solutions_main2 .product_list ul li:nth-child(3){width:25%}.solutions_main2 .product_list ul li:nth-child(4){width:25%}.solutions_main2 .product_list .product_box h2{font-size:16px;color:#009de0;background:#fff;margin-right:8px;padding:10px 0;font-weight:700;text-align:center;text-transform:uppercase;margin-bottom:8px;position:relative;z-index:2;height:50px;display:flex;flex-wrap:wrap;align-items:center;justify-content:center}.solutions_main2 .left_side{padding:25px;background:#fff;height:100%}.solutions_main2 .indu_content .row{position:relative;margin-bottom:30px}.solutions_main2 .indu_content .row:before{content:'';position:absolute;left:-16%;top:18px;width:0;height:40px;background:#009de0;z-index:1;transition:2s}.solutions_main2 .product_list .indu_content .row.animate:before{width:232%}.solutions_main2 .right_side{padding:25px;background:#fff;height:100%;position:relative;z-index:1}.solutions_main2 .right_side img{height:350px;object-fit:cover}.solutions_main2 .left_side h4{color:#fff;position:relative;z-index:1;margin:4px 0 20px;font-weight:700;font-size:20px}.solutions_main2{overflow:hidden;position:relative}.solutions_main2 .indu_content{background:0 0}.solutions_main .title{margin-top:35%}.read_more{text-decoration:none!important;position:absolute;bottom:20px;display:inline-block}.read_more h2{font-weight:600;font-size:16px;margin:0;position:relative;border:1px solid #009de0;color:#009de0;display:inline-block;padding:6px;z-index:2}.read_more h2:before{position:absolute;top:0;left:0;display:block;width:0;height:100%;content:'';-webkit-transition:width .3s ease;-o-transition:width .3s ease;transition:width .3s ease;background:#009de0;z-index:-1}.read_more:hover h2{color:#fff}.read_more:hover h2:before{width:100%}#solutions_bnner{position:absolute;left:0;width:100%;height:100vh;z-index:0}.tabs_sec{padding:20px 0;color:#000}.tabs_sec h3{font-size:18px;font-weight:800;color:#009de0;margin:10px 0 20px;text-transform:uppercase}.tabs_sec p.sub_head{color:#0e0f3b;font-size:16px;font-weight:700;margin:12px 0;text-transform:uppercase}.tabs_sec .appli li{width:100%}.tabs_sec .appli{display:inline;font-size:16px;font-weight:600;color:#0e0f3b;list-style:none}.tabs_sec .proce{list-style:decimal;padding-left:25px}.tabs_sec .proce li::marker{font-weight:700}.tabs_sec .proce li a{font-weight:400;text-transform:capitalize;color:#007bff;padding:0;text-align:unset;text-decoration:underline}.tabs_sec.case img{height:300px;object-fit:cover;width:100%}.tabs_sec.case a{text-align:center;padding:15px;background:#009de0;color:#fff;margin-top:20px;text-transform:uppercase;position:relative;text-decoration:none;display:block;z-index:0;font-weight:700}.tabs_sec .appli li:before{content:'\f0da';font-weight:700;margin-right:10px;font-family:"Font Awesome 5 Free"}.tabs_sec.case a:before{position:absolute;top:0;left:0;display:block;width:0;height:100%;content:'';-webkit-transition:width .3s ease;-o-transition:width .3s ease;transition:width .3s ease;background:#fff;z-index:-1}.tabs_sec.case a:hover:before{width:100%}.tabs_sec.case a:hover{color:#009de0}.csc-default th{font-size:14px;text-align:left;padding:2px 5px;border-bottom:1px solid #ccc;color:#000}.csc-default .tr-odd td{background-color:#efefef;padding:2px 5px;font-size:14px}.csc-default .tr-even td{background-color:#dfdfdf;padding:2px 5px;font-size:14px}.csc-default h3{font-size:14px;margin:20px 0 10px}.csc-default .table-bordered td,.table-bordered th{border:1px solid #fff}.service.inner_banner .title h3{width:100%;color:#fff;background:0 0;height:auto}.service.inner_banner{min-height:65vh}.service_sec .ser_list{position:relative;overflow:hidden;margin:15px 0;width:350px}.service_sec .ser_list img{width:100%;height:350px;object-fit:cover}.service_sec .ser_list a{position:absolute;width:100%;text-align:center;left:0;top:0;display:block;background:rgb(0 157 224/80%);color:#fff;font-weight:700;padding:12px;text-decoration:none;transition:all .5s ease;height:45px;overflow:hidden}.service_sec .ser_list:hover a{height:100%}.service_sec .col-md-4:nth-child(even) .ser_list a{bottom:0;top:unset;background:rgb(255 255 255/80%);color:#009de0}.service_sec .ser_list a p{margin:10px;border-top:1px solid;padding:10px 0}